Government-backed Revenue Stream

Solar 21 is fundamentally structured around government supports for renewable energy generation called Feed in Tariffs (read more about Feed in Tariffs here). Feed-in Tariffs were introduced for the purpose of encouraging the development of renewable energy sources in Europe and beyond. The tariffs are typically guaranteed for a period of 20 years.

The system of Feed-in Tariffs ensures a minimum guaranteed price for the electricity produced together with a guarantee that all of the energy produced will be purchased by the grid, thus providing a reliable, predictable and stable income stream. In this way, renewable energy is unaffected by market volatility, unlike traditional investment classes.
